    What Is the Crisis and What Is Causing It?The water crisis facing humanity results from two basic facts: humans are using water at a

    rate much faster than nature can replenish it, and at the same time, some uses that humans

    have for water are degrading the biological habitat. Issues surrounding water become further

    intensied when water is viewed as a source of economic or political power, which has led tomoral and ethical questions related to ownership, rights to use, and management of water.

    The issues to be faced by politicians and corporations alike are very complicated and seri-

    ous. How will we bring together more energy production with other water requirements? If we

    want to produce more energy, well need more and more water to do so. There may be limits onhow much hydropower we can produce, how much cooling water will be available for nuclear

    power plants, and how high prices can be set. Two years ago, West African farmers could not

    aord to pump water from wells to irrigate crops because of the higher cost for energy. How do

    we bring together the need to use river water to light Bangkok and still serve the one million

    shermen in Cambodia who are dependent for their livelihoods on the same river?

    Bergkamp recommends putting in place institutions that can manage the distribution and

    access to water. The institutions need to be locally grounded and have local capacities to man-

    age and innovate. Second, we need to be looking at investing in a green economy that focuses

    on eciency, on ecological tax reforms, on incentives to not pollute and actually to depollute.

    Third, we need to invest in people focusing on secondary education and networked water uni-

    versities where students learn to work in an integrated and interdisciplinary manner.

    The means to codify the right to water might include broad guidelines laid down in a con-

    stitutional framework, providing principles by which water managers could make decisions.

    Water might be included in the human rights outlined in the United Nations Declaration on

    Human Rights; however, as water is bought and sold on a global market, it becomes accessible

    only to those who have the means to purchase it. In the last three years, some 140 nation-states

    have formally recognized the right to water but this has not yet translated into national legisla-

    tion or changes in constitutions. Expected next year is a report from a United Nations Special

    Envoy on right to water, working through the UN Commission on Human Rights.

    2. Iscontemporarywaterpolicyanoutcomeo aharmonious collaborationbetween

    naturalscienceandsocialscience?

    Science can only explain the behavior of water resource systems, and forecast their po-

    tential behavior in response to various alternatives of resource utilization. Science cannot

    make policy. Policy has to reconcile science knowledge with societal values. Thus, science

    and policy are interwoven. Without a constructive coming together of science and societal

    values, water cannot be managed to achieve equitable sharing among all segments of society.
